subroutine SDRVRF3 (integer nout, integer nn, integer, dimension( nn ) nval, real thresh, real, dimension( lda, * ) a, integer lda, real, dimension( * ) arf, real, dimension( lda, * ) b1, real, dimension( lda, * ) b2, real, dimension( * ) s_work_slange, real, dimension( * ) s_work_sgeqrf, real, dimension( * ) tau)

SDRVRF3

Purpose:

!>
!> SDRVRF3 tests the LAPACK RFP routines:
!>     STFSM
!> 

Parameters

NOUT

!>          NOUT is INTEGER
!>                The unit number for output.
!> 

NN

!>          NN is INTEGER
!>                The number of values of N contained in the vector NVAL.
!> 

NVAL

!>          NVAL is INTEGER array, dimension (NN)
!>                The values of the matrix dimension N.
!> 

THRESH

!>          THRESH is REAL
!>                The threshold value for the test ratios.  A result is
!>                included in the output file if RESULT >= THRESH.  To have
!>                every test ratio printed, use THRESH = 0.
!> 

A

!>          A is REAL array, dimension (LDA,NMAX)
!> 

LDA

!>          LDA is INTEGER
!>                The leading dimension of the array A.  LDA >= max(1,NMAX).
!> 

ARF

!>          ARF is REAL array, dimension ((NMAX*(NMAX+1))/2).
!> 

B1

!>          B1 is REAL array, dimension (LDA,NMAX)
!> 

B2

!>          B2 is REAL array, dimension (LDA,NMAX)
!> 

S_WORK_SLANGE

!>          S_WORK_SLANGE is REAL array, dimension (NMAX)
!> 

S_WORK_SGEQRF

!>          S_WORK_SGEQRF is REAL array, dimension (NMAX)
!> 

TAU

!>          TAU is REAL array, dimension (NMAX)
!>
